A research team from Santé Québec – CHU Sainte-Justine and the University of Montreal has demonstrated for the first time that a non-invasive brain monitoring technique could predict the future development of babies born prematurely. In this work, among the 241 participating babies born between 29 and 36 weeks of pregnancy, one in three presented a developmental delay at the age of two.
Unlike very premature babies (less than 29 weeks), who are already subject to systematic monitoring, this population – although representing the majority of premature births – is less monitored.
“Very premature babies have been studied extensively by scientists – and are systematically followed by a pediatrician – while those born between 29 and 36 weeks have been less so. Science therefore knows less about the consequences of their prematurity on their development. The majority of these babies leave the hospital without further follow-up as if they had been born at full term,” explains Marie-Noëlle Simard, occupational therapist at Santé Québec – CHU Sainte-Justine and professor at the UdeM School of Rehabilitation.
